Ahead of the Summer Olympic Games, basketball player Brittney Griner spoke with the Associated Press.
Professional basketball player Brittney Griner opened up in an interview published on Monday about the recent birth of her son and her hopes to win Olympic gold at the 2024 Summer Olympic Games.In February 2022, Griner was arrested in Russia for having less than a gram of medically prescribed THC, which is not legal in Russia.
